Highest Education Level

Railroad Engineers in Washington offer the following education background
Bachelor's Degree
26.1%
High School or GED
26.1%
Master's Degree
17.0%
Associate's Degree
14.8%
Vocational Degree or Certification
12.5%
Some College
3.4%
